Logo recipes Recipe Instructions Combine all ingredients in a large bowl.Be sure to break up any clumps that develop from essential oils.Store in an airtight container, in a dark, cool place indefinitely.For use: Add 1/2 cup of bath salts to your bath just before getting in.

1. Combine all ingredients in a large bowl.
2. Be sure to break up any clumps that develop from essential oils.
3. Store in an airtight container, in a dark, cool place indefinitely.
4. For use: Add 1/2 cup of bath salts to your bath just before getting in.
